AI Engineer (Applied/Software), M365, SharePoint & Power Platform
Education
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Data, Engineering, or a related field, or equivalent practical experience.
TrainingMicrosoft Copilot Studio, Power Platform, Azure AI, or related Microsoft certification preferred.
Practical experience in prompt design, AI evaluation, knowledge grounding, or responsible AI preferred.
Work Experience4+ years in AI solution development, automation, application development, data platforms, or enterprise technology.
Hands‑on experience building AI agents, copilots, chatbots, workflow automations, or advanced digital assistants.
Experience with Microsoft Copilot Studio, Power Automate, Power Apps, SharePoint, Teams, Dataverse, or Azure AI.
Experience building internal tools for operations, human resources, IT, finance, supply chain, stores, or customer‑facing teams preferred.
Retail or multi‑site enterprise experience preferred.
Skills- Strong understanding of prompt design, knowledge grounding, and AI testing methods
- Ability to design agent instructions, conversation flows, prompts, knowledge grounding, actions, and escalation paths
- Comfort configuring approved knowledge sources such as SharePoint, Dataverse, SQL, Service Now, internal documents, and enterprise data
- Ability to work directly with business users and translate needs into practical AI solutions
- Strong problem‑solving skills and comfort working in fast‑moving, ambiguous environments
- Familiarity with Retrieval‑Augmented Generation (RAG) patterns, Azure OpenAI, Microsoft Graph, APIs, enterprise search, AI safety, access controls, and data privacy preferred
- Build AI agents, copilots, and assistant experiences using Microsoft Copilot Studio, Azure AI Studio, Power Platform, SharePoint, Teams, and related Microsoft tools
- Design agent instructions, conversation flows, prompts, knowledge grounding, actions, and escalation paths
- Configure approved knowledge sources such as SharePoint, Dataverse, SQL, Service Now, internal documents, and enterprise data
- Partner with business stakeholders to clarify requirements and convert use cases into working prototypes
- Test agent performance for accuracy, completeness, hallucination risk, usability, and business fit
- Improve agent quality through prompt refinement, knowledge tuning, evaluation frameworks, and user feedback
- Package successful prototypes into reusable templates, starter prompts, and build patterns
- Document agent configuration, data sources, known limitations, support model, and adoption guidance
- Support pilots, collect feedback, and iterate quickly toward production readiness
